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: Older than 18 and younger than 80 years, patients with unilateral or bilateral neck pain.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: Any neurological disorders, problems with vision and hearing, vestibular pathology, or other neurological deficits, had undergone any previous spinal surgery, were diagnosed with serious spinal pathology (cancer, inflammatory arthropathy, or acute vertebral fracture), or were currently pregnant.

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Evaluate Pain Intensity and Neck Disability Index at 3 or 6 months after initial visit.

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
Fremantle neck awareness questionnaire, Tampa scale for kinesiofobia, Pain catastrophizing scale
